A new robotic hand capable of switching between multiple grippers using a single motor
Kanazawa University researchers built a multi-gripper robotic hand driven by one motor. Its MaGDri mechanism uses gravity to redirect torque between grippers, allowing prototypes to select grips for differently shaped and sized objects while potentially reducing weight, space, and cost.

Undergrads’ weed-killing robot wins top prize
Cornell students won The Farm Robotics Challenge with an autonomous, low-energy electric weeding robot for vineyards and orchards. Their $50,000 prize supports Rootline Robotics, which will refine and validate the herbicide-free system with growers before market.

Engineers develop robot that judges its surroundings and walks, runs, and jumps like an animal
KAIST’s KAIST HOUND uses APT-RL, a depth camera, and LiDAR to choose walking, running, jumping, trotting, or bounding for changing terrain. Tests on campus and forest trails showed stable obstacle traversal and a peak instantaneous speed of six meters per second.

Fujitsu and leading Japanese robotics companies to use Nvidia technology in 'physical AI'
Fujitsu, Nvidia, Fanuc, Yaskawa Electric, and Kawasaki Heavy Industries will collaborate on physical-AI robots for workplaces, homes, and hospitals. The effort aims to address Japan’s labor shortage and aging population, with an initial phase planned for later in 2026.

A flapping robot swims and flies like a diving bird
EPFL and MIT engineers built a sub-300-gram flapping robot that swims underwater and takes off into flight, offering a platform for bird-mechanics research and potential aquatic sampling missions.

AI agents create virtual playgrounds to help robots get crucial training data
MIT researchers developed SceneSmith, a three-agent system that generates detailed, physics-ready indoor simulations from text prompts. The virtual scenes help test robot policies before real-world deployment, though creating each scene can take hours.

Batter up, bias down: Robot umpires curb favoritism for star hitters
A University of Michigan study found that South Korea’s automated ball-strike system reduced the apparent advantages of famous hitters, who recorded more strikeouts, fewer walks and lower on-base rates than lesser-known batters after its introduction. No comparable pattern was found for star pitchers.

Wristband enables wearers to control a robotic hand with their own movements
MIT researchers created an AI-enabled ultrasound wristband that tracks hand motion from wrist images and wirelessly controls a robotic hand or virtual objects. Tests with eight volunteers showed tracking across gestures, grasps, sign-language letters, and object handling.
